图书介绍

Windows Mobile平台应用与开发PDF|Epub|txt|kindle电子书版本网盘下载

Windows Mobile平台应用与开发
  • 刘彦博,胡砚,马骐编著 著
  • 出版社: 北京:人民邮电出版社
  • ISBN:7115148708
  • 出版时间:2006
  • 标注页数:462页
  • 文件大小:144MB
  • 文件页数:484页
  • 主题词:移动通信-携带电话机-应用程序-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

Windows Mobile平台应用与开发P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 WindowsMobile 5.0及信息与安全服务套件(MSFP)1

1.1 什么是Windows Mobile1

1.2 Windows Mobile家族1

1.3 Windows Mobile全球市场发展状况3

1.4 Windows Mobile 5.03

1.5 Windows Mobile 5.0的新特性3

1.5.1 Mobile Office介绍4

1.5.3 Windows Media Player 10 Mobile5

1.5.2 Mobile IE介绍5

1.5.4 Microsoft ActiveSync 4.1应用程序6

1.6 Windows Mobile 5.0信息与安全服务套件(MSFP)7

1.6.1 功能特性8

1.6.2信息与安全服务套件(MSFP)部署设置和最优方法10

1.7企业移动需求14

1.8 小结14

第2章 .NET Compact Framework简介15

2.1 Windows Mobile平台及.NETFramework精简版架构15

2.2支持的语言和平台16

2.1.2.NET Framework精简版类库16

2.1.1公共语言运行库16

2.3.NET Framework和.NET Framework精简版应用程序类型比较17

2.4.NET Framework精简版中常用类库窗体控件18

2.5.NET Framework精简版2.0新特色19

2.5.1用户界面19

2.5.2数据访问22

2.5.3通信23

2.5.5线程24

2.5.4安全24

2.5.6性能和资源管理25

2.5.7小结26

第3章 Visual Studio 2005简介27

3.1开发环境概况27

3.1.1用户界面27

3.1.2支持的项目类型31

3.1.3解决方案、项目和构成项34

3.1.4外部工具34

3.2使用集成开发环境35

3.2.1设置项目属性36

3.2.2管理类型38

3.2.3编辑代码43

3.2.4添加和编辑资源48

3.3获取帮助50

3.3.1使用动态帮助50

3.3.2使用Document Explorer50

3.4小结55

4.1.2 WAP的形成过程56

4.1.1 WAP的起源56

4.1WAP简介56

第4章 WAP和WML56

4.1.3 WAP架构说明57

4.1.4 WAP协议介绍59

4.1.5WAP的未来61

4.2 WML语言基础62

4.2.1什么是WML文件62

4.2.2 WML程序结构63

4.2.3 WML语言的基本知识65

4.3.2 WMLScript的主要优点及其字节码解释器68

4.3 WML Script语法基础68

4.3.1在WML程序中调用WMLScript函数68

4.3.3 WMLScript基本规则69

4.3.4变量与数据类型70

4.3.5操作符与表达式72

4.3.6 WMLScript异常处理72

4.4 小结73

5.1.3移动应用程序结构74

5.1.2移动Web站点74

5.1.1 ASP.NET 2.0概述74

5.1 ASP.NET移动功能74

第5章 用ASP.NET开发移动Web站点74

5.1.4移动Web服务器控件75

5.1.5 ASP.NET Web服务器控件和统一适配器结构75

5.1.6选择自定义适配器或移动控件75

5.2创建移动Web站点76

5.2.1创建Web站点项目76

5.3移动Web窗体介绍77

5.2.2 向项目中添加移动Web页面77

5.3.2客户端脚本78

5.3.3 开发“Hello World”应用的国际化版本78

5.3.1 服务器端应用程序78

5.3.4 为国际化的应用程序更改文本编码80

5.3.5移动Web窗体的生命周期81

5.3.6移动Web窗体的生命周期阶段81

5.3.7窗体标记内的文本81

5.3.8在移动Web窗体之间进行链接82

5.3.11使用模拟器测试移动Web站点86

5.3.9 处理卡片(Card)组的大小限制86

5.3.10减少页的呈现大小86

5.4使用移动Web控件89

5.4.1 移动Web控件简介89

5.4.2使用移动Web控件构建页面90

5.4.3移动Web应用开发工具90

5.4.4使用Visual Studio 2005创建移动Web项目91

5.4.5添加移动设备的Web窗体91

5.4.6 ASP.NET移动控件的事件处理93

5.4.7使用容器控件94

5.5创建自定义移动Web控件95

5.5.1 用户控件96

5.5.2通过继承扩展控件功能99

5.5.3创建组合控件101

5.5.4编写自己的控件102

5.5.5设备过滤和适配103

5.6小结103

6.1 Web Service的概念104

第6章 用ASP.NET开发Web Service104

6.1.1 WSDL105

6.1.2 HTTP发送请求的方法108

6.1.3 SOAP109

6.1.4 UDDI111

6.2为什么应用Web Service112

6.2.1 Web Service的优势112

6.3如何创建一个Web Service114

6.3.1 HelloWorld示例114

6.2.2什么时候不应该使用Web Service114

6.3.2理解服务代码和后台代码116

6.3.3 WebMethod特性116

6.3.4如何创建一个Web Service119

6.4小结127

第7章 用户界面设计128

7.1 使用控件创建应用程序界面129

7.1.1 .NET Compact Framework中的控件129

7.1.2处理控件的事件130

7.1.3使用控件131

7.1.4控件布局的基本原则137

7.2用户界面设计原则与技巧138

7.2.1基本原则138

7.2.2在窗体间进行导航139

7.2.3向用户提供反馈147

7.3 界面因素对用户界面的影响153

7.3.1屏幕方向153

7.3.2软输入面板156

7.4小结158

第8章 用户输入和屏幕绘图技术159

8.1 鼠标输入159

8.1.1 鼠标事件159

8.1.2 自动鼠标捕获162

8.2键盘输入162

8.2.1使用软输入面板162

8.2.2键盘事件165

8.2.3键盘事件参数165

8.3 使用GDI+进行屏幕绘图168

8.3.1 GDI+简介169

8.3.2绘图表面169

8.3.3 颜色、画笔和画刷171

8.3.4绘制基本图形177

8.3.5绘制文本182

8.3.6绘制图像194

8.3.7结合鼠标事件绘图201

8.4 小结207

9.2.1 建立Web Services项目208

9.2 如何使用Web Services208

第9章 访问Web Services208

9.1 为什么要在Windows Mobile程序中使用Web Services208

9.2.2 引用Web Services209

9.2.3使用Web Services213

9.2.4 Web Services调用中发生了什么214

9.3通过Web Services访问数据集214

9.3.1使用Web Services返回数据集215

9.3.2通过Web Services访问类型化的数据集218

9.4.1使用单向的Web Services224

9.4优化使用了Web Services的程序224

9.4.2异步调用Web Services225

9.4.3其他注意事项228

9.5 小结228

第10章 测试环境的搭建和客户端的部署229

10.1基于Visual Studio 2005的测试环境229

10.1.1 Windows Mobile虚拟设备简介229

10.1.2配置虚拟设备管理器235

10.1.3使用ActiveSync进行同步和浏览241

10.1.4安装其他语言和版本虚拟设备镜像243

10.1.5测试245

10.2部署Windows Mobile应用程序245

10.2.1 部署.NET Compact Framework 2.0245

10.2.2使用ActiveSync进行部署249

10.2.3 使用CeCopy进行部署250

10.2.4制作CAB安装包251

10.2.5 分发CAB安装包259

10.3 小结261

第11章 用ADO.NET访问数据262

11.1 ADO.NET概述262

11.1.1 ADO.NET架构262

11.1.2两种访问数据的方式263

11.1.3 ADO.NET与XML264

11.2 ADO.NET的基本构成和工作原理264

11.2.1选择Data Provider264

11.2.2定义和管理数据连接265

11.2.3创建命令对象267

11.3.1持续连接的工作环境270

11.3 使用ADO.NET进行数据访问270

11.3.2断开式结构272

11.3.3 用ADO.NET 读写XML276

11.3.4处理异常282

11.4 小结283

第12章 SQL Mobile本地数据访问284

12.1 SQL Mobile简介284

12.2第一个SQL Mobile程序286

12.2.1添加数据源286

12.2.2数据浏览界面291

12.2.3数据绑定控件293

12.2.4数据表关联295

12.2.5创建自定义查询298

12.2.6添加新数据300

12.3数据访问对象302

12.3.1 神奇的DataSet303

12.3.2 TableAdapter313

12.3.3 BindingSource320

12.4.1创建SQL Mobile数据库322

12.4 SQL Mobile数据库的生命周期322

12.4.2管理SQL Mobile数据库323

12.4.3删除、备份、恢复数据库324

12.5SQL Mobile管理工具324

12.5.1使用Visual Studio 2005管理SQL Mobile324

12.5.2使用SQL Server 2005管理SQL Mobile327

12.5.3SQL ServerCE Query Analyzer329

12.6安装SQL Mobile330

12.6.1SQL Mobile安装文件331

12.6.2安装SQL Mobile332

12.7SQL Mobile安全性333

12.7.1移动设备的安全挑战333

12.7.2SQL Mobile安全特性333

12.8小结335

第13章 SQL Mobile远程数据访问336

13.1远程数据同步介绍336

13.1.1Remote Data Access(RDA)337

13.1.2SQL Server Mobile Replication337

13.1.3 RDA与Replication比较338

13.2配置SQL Mobile Server Tools339

13.3RDA344

13.3.1RDA架构344

13.3.2创建RDA程序346

13.3.3RDA的局限性350

13.3.4 RDA错误处理350

13.3.5多用户访问351

13.4 Replication351

13.4.1 Replication介绍351

13.4.2创建Publication353

13.4.3创建Subscriber358

13.4.4创建Replication程序362

13.4.5 Replication的局限性364

13.4.6 Replication冲突解决365

13.5 Web Service访问远程数据库365

13.5.1SQL查询分析器366

13.5.2与SQL Server CE交互371

13.6小结374

14.1使用电话功能376

第14章 使用电话功能和Pocket Outlook服务376

14.2 Pocket Outlook服务380

14.2.1 Pocket Outlook对象模型380

14.2.2使用Pocket Outlook服务384

14.2.3访问短信息服务386

14.2.4访问Email服务388

14.2.5接收短信息和Email消息391

14.2.6访问联系人服务396

14.2.7访问日历服务400

14.2.8访问任务服务405

14.3小结409

第15章 使用IrDA进行连接和数据通信411

15.1 IrDA概述411

15.2发现红外设备412

15.3监听红外连接413

15.4发送数据414

15.5使用红外传输文件415

15.5.1建立发送端程序415

15.5.2建立接收端程序417

15.6小结420

15.5.3测试程序的运行420

第16章 访问全球定位系统(GPS)API421

16.1全球定位系统(GPS)介绍421

16.2 GPS如何工作421

16.3差分GPS422

16.4 GPS应用422

16.5 GPS的传统编程422

16.5.1 串口通信423

16.5.2 NMEA命令和数据处理424

16.6 Windows Mobile5的GPSID最新函数库426

16.6.1 GPS Intermediate Driver(GPSID)介绍427

16.6.2 GPSID应用开发427

16.6.3 引用GPSID函数库427

16.6.4使用GPSID得到解析后的GPS数据429

16.7 Pocket PC 5.0如何使用蓝牙连接GPS433

16.7.1 关于GPS接收机433

16.7.2如何使用Pocket PC 5.0连接GPS接收机433

16.8测试串口通信GPS应用436

16.9测试GPSID应用438

16.10小结439

第17章 Windows Mobile的安全特性440

17.1 Windows Mobile的移动特性以及广泛应用440

17.2 Windows Mobile所面临的安全风险和挑战442

17.2.1安全模型442

17.2.2移动设备安全特性443

17.3将Windows Mobile引入现有企业安全架构444

17.3.1保护企业架构444

17.3.2保护移动网络445

17.3.3保护移动设备447

17.4从服务器平台对Windows Mobile进行管理449

17.4.1 Exchange Server2003449

17.4.2 System Management Server 2003455

17.5 Messaging&SecurityFeature Pack for Windows Mobile 5.0461

17.5.1 远程强制IT策略461

17.5.2删除本地和远程设备信息462

17.5.3基于许可证的身份认证过程462

17.6小结462

热门推荐